Scientists working at Vancouver’s Olympic doping lab say so far so good. They have reported athletes’ test results have come back negative so far. Over 200 blood and urine tests have been submitted and the lab will continue until all athletes are tested. That would be 2000 samples by this Friday.
The facility is being held inside the Richmond Oval on-site at the Olympic venues. Screening begins during the day when athletes deposit a sample which a courier takes to the lab by courier for the overnight staff to process paperwork and initial screenings.
Test results are complete within 24 hours as required by the International Olympic Committee and scientists are working around the clock to meet a quick turn around time.
